Everton will have a low-key window, says football director

Everton suffered a 3-1 defeat to Manchester City on Wednesday night.

While the Toffees were on the ascendency, following their 10-point deduction by the Premier League, they had risen to becoming one of the form teams in the competition, winning four games on the bounce.

Despite that they’ve suffered three defeats in their last three outings across all competitions, with the Toffees now 17th in the table, one- point off the relegation zone.

Amid the construction of their new stadium, Everton are currently working on a much tighter budget than we have seen them before, with their director of football Kevin Thelwell advising fans this week not expect ‘a great deal of transfer business’ in January.

He said, according to the Liverpool Echo: ‘The evolution of a squad can be a challenge when fiscal prudence is also a key factor. But progress and financial diligence can be delivered together.

‘And so, as we look to January, I can assure you that, whilst there may not be a great deal of transfer business taking place in the coming weeks, it does not mean the hard work is not continuing.’

Newcastle hoping to do their business late in the window

While Ange Postecoglou wants to get deals in the door quickly, it seems other sides are predicting things to be a little slower in January.

Eddie Howe is preparing to do business later on in the window, rather than at the beginning.

The Magpies have a raft of injuries and the Newcastle boss admitted his team would be analysing whether they need to bolster their squad or can hold out until they return.

Nick Pope, who recently dislocated his shoulder, harvey Barnes and Jacob Murphy are among those sidlined at the moment, while Sandro Tonali is currently serving a 10-month ban after breaching betting rules.

When asked on whether his side’s long injury list was something that had changed his mind about what’s needed in January, Howe said: ‘Not currently because we’re still in the process of analysing who is coming back and when.’

Breaking: Andre Onana named in Cameroon squad

Man United goalkeeper Andre Onana has been named in Cameroon’s squad for the Africa Cup of Nations.

It comes after he was involved in rows with manager Rigobert Song that led to him being booted out of their 2022 World Cup squad.

With Altay Bayindir and Tom Heaton waiting in the wings, United are well covered for back-up options between the sticks and could look to strengthen their squad elsewhere.

According to Correio da Manha, United are ‘mulling a move for Viktor Gyokeres’ of Sporting Lisbon.

The forward has an £87million release clause after he signed for the Portuguese outfit from Coventry City in the summer.

Barcelona willing to let Marcos Alonso and Sergi Roberto leave

The Spanish champions are reportedly ready to let Marcos Alonso and Sergi Roberto leave the club at the end of the season.

Rather than tieing them down to new contracts, Football Espana claim that the pair are set to be released instead of keeping them on.

Despite that, LaLiga rivals Atletico Madrid are rumoured to be keen on acquiring the pair – having previously shown an interest in Alonso earlier this summer.

Postecoglou insists he wants new signings quickly

Tottenham boss Ange Postecoglou has insisted he is looking to make some quick signings in the January transfer window, amid injuries to key players.

Spurs currently have a raft of key players out of action, with their squad set to be depleated even further with Son Heung-min, Pape Matar Sarr and Yves Bissouma all set to depart the club in the coming months for international tournaments.

Cristian Romero, meanwhile is set to be ruled out of action for several weeks due to a hamstring strain, while Ivan perisic, Rodrigo Bentancur, Micky van de Ven and James Maddison, amongst others are all out with injury.

‘We’ll tackle it like we’ve tackled everything else,’ Postecoglou said on the upcoming transfer window. ‘We’ve just got to get on with it.

‘You can see other clubs going through it as well. We’ve been going through it for quite a while, but I like the attitude everyone is taking internally.

‘We’ve still been disappointed with our losses, still disappointed if we’re not playing our football. That’s the most important thing.

‘I like the fact we’re winning games and playing decent football without some of those players.’

Could Raphael Varane be set for a Man United exit?

Amid what’s been an up and down season for the central defender, Raphael Varane has struggled to string together a consistent run of games.

Amid several injuries and a drop-off in form, Varane has now only managed five Premier League starts so far this season, with Harry Maguire and Victor Lindelof both being favoured over the French defender.

But it now appears Bayern Munich and Real Madrid could be set to battle it out for Varane.

Bayern Munich sporting director Christoph Freund has recently been vocal on their hopes to sign a new defender and the Bundesliga champions could have a budget of around £20million to spend on a new defender.
